Bodafon Park Lodge, located in Tyn-y-Gongl, Gwynedd, Wales, is a holiday home that sleeps 6 people in 3 bedrooms. Situated near the Anglesey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, this lodge is a short distance from the coast and Benllech beach. The property is managed by Coastal Holidays, offering a self-catering option ideal for a relaxed holiday.
The open plan living and dining area includes a fully fitted kitchen with essential appliances. The lodge features three bedrooms - a double room and two twin rooms - all equipped with quilts, pillows, and mattress protectors. Guests will need to bring their own duvet covers, pillowcases, and bed sheets. The bathroom includes a shower over the bath, as well as a separate shower room and toilet. Wi-Fi is available for an additional charge.
Outside, guests can enjoy pleasant views from the decking platform and dine al fresco with the provided table and chairs. Bodafon Holiday Park is a family-friendly location within walking distance of Benllech village, offering shops, restaurants, pubs, and the beach. Nearby attractions include Mynydd Bodafon walks, Moelfre Beach, Lligwy Beach, and the Moelfre Seawatch Centre. The property also includes amenities such as central heating, a patio, a luxury fitted kitchen, and allows pets for an additional fee.
